For some reason when I try to build my drawers even though I have a Philips screwdriver I can’t seem to get the first screws to go through what could I do ?
Hello GIANNA :) Make sure the screws are going in straight.. it's easy to get them started a little sideways.. IF this is the case they will start screwing in but will bind up...I like to make sure they are straight by starting them with my fingers and tighten them as much as possible by hand then finishing with the driver .. What would be the best way to undo the middle pieces if someone’s happened to put those in first? 😢
Referring to the part where you apply the wooden pieces
DO NOT try to remove the plastic pieces!! simply unscrew the portion that holds the sides together.. then it is easy to put the slats in and secure them in place
Hello KIBBS, I actually made this mistake when doing the bed.. it can be fixed :) take off the head board by unscrewing the two bolts on either side.. then remove the foot board.. then take out the screws that hold the sides together on the middle cross beam.. once those are loos you can have someone help you pull the bar out a bit to where you can put all the wooden slats in .. just start at one end and put the tip in a little ways.. then go to the next slat.. you don't want to push it in all the way right away or you wont have room to put the next one in.. it's a little tricky but you got it :) I did it by myself ;) I hope this helps :)
